Red de conocimiento informático - Aprendizaje de código fuente - ¿Significa que no se requieren sockets para los programas locales, pero sí para los programas de red?

¿Significa que no se requieren sockets para los programas locales, pero sí para los programas de red?

Los programas de red generalmente implementan la interacción de diversa información a través de métodos de comunicación de red, como protocolos de conexión de red (como HTTP, FTP), y los sockets son una buena tecnología de programación de comunicación de red, por lo que los programas de red generales requieren sockets.

Los programas locales generalmente realizan la interacción de información a través de tecnología de canal y memoria compartida. Cuando los programas locales no necesitan o rara vez necesitan transmitir información a través de la red, no necesitan usar tecnología de socket.

Pero algunos programas locales especiales también utilizan tecnología de socket para acceder a direcciones IP locales y obtener información.